Pinkneys Road is a well-established residential road in Maidenhead, positioned close to the open spaces of Pinkneys Green while remaining conveniently placed for the town's amenities. Maidenhead town centre offers a good range of shops, restaurants and everyday conveniences, with the Elizabeth Line providing direct and convenient connections into London. The area also benefits from easy access to local schools, countryside walks and the M4 motorway.
